條件:① 調試的線上項目和本地項目是同樣。 ② 在線上服務器上的tomcat 的bin目錄下的startup.sh文件裏添加 declare -x CATALINA_OPTS="-server -Xdebug -Xnoagent -Djava.compiler=NONE -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=8797" 注意:address=8797 這個是端口,隨便設置一個,可是不要重複啊 本地會用到 如圖: ③ 而後在本地的eclipse裏點擊debug的Debug configuration (如圖進行相應的配置) java
而後點擊debug。 ④在本地把須要打斷點的地方打上斷點,而後運行線上服務器,就可在本地debug啦。tomcat